PARKING AND TRANSPORTATION SERVICES

Visitors and Department Guests

Vehicles parked on campus must display a valid permit or be parked at a paid meter from 6 a.m. to 8 p.m. Monday through Thursday and 6 a.m. to 3 p.m. Friday.  Permits are not required in most locations from 3 p.m. Friday to 6 a.m. Monday or when the university is officially closed for a holiday or inclement weather.  Reserved spaces and restricted lots are enforced at all times, with restriction information posted at lots and reserved spaces.  The posted information takes priority over printed information and the use of gates. 

NOTE:  Scratch off permits and yellow visitor permits are non-refundable and are no longer valid. 

Campus Visitors

Visitors must park in a visitor lot or at a paid meter.  Visitor permits, which must be displayed clearly on the dash, may be purchased at a pay station.   Meters with various time frames of up to 2 hours are available in limited locations throughout the campus.  Visitor lots are located in the following areas:

  • Towsontown Garage (Pay Station Location)
  • Lot 2 Near Stephens Hall - (Restricted to Guest with Department Paid Parking - Pay Station Location)
  • Administration Building Front Lot (Pay Station Location)
  • Lot 11 Outside of the Union Garage (Pay Station Location)
  • All Towson Center lots, except 21a - (13, 14, 19, 20 & 21) (Pay Station Location - lot 13 & 21)

SPECIFIC SPORT PARKING INFORMATION

Baseball

  • Season parking Pass: Are available for purchase at the pay station in Lot 11 and the Towsontown Garage next to Schuerholz Park for $25.  Season Passes are valid in Commuter and Visitor spaces in Lot 11 and the Towsontown Garage 1 hour prior to the game through one hour after the game concludes.  Season Passes must be displayed on you dashboard.
  • Game Day Purchase: Should be purchased at the pay station in the Towsontown Garage and should be used in the Towsontown Garage.  Pass is good for the number of hours purchased at $2 hour.

Softball and Tennis

  • Season Parking Pass : Are available for purchase at the Pay Stations in Lot 13 and Lot 21.  Season passes are valid in all Towson Center lots except lot 21a (after 3 pm, you can go in 21a).  Passes are good for one hour prior to game time through one hour after the completion of the game.  Passes must be displayed on car dashboard.

                            Softball - $25

                            Women’s Tennis - $8

  • Game Day Purchase: Should be purchased at the pay stations in Lot 13 and Lot 21.  Pass is good for any Towson Center Lot for the number of hours purchased at $2 per hour.

Women's Lacrosse

  • Based of their schedule the only time that visitors would have to pay for parking is if there is a men’s lacrosse game prior or following a women’s game.  There will be attendants in the lots for you to pay.

Men's Lacrosse

  • Season Parking Pass : are available for purchase at the Ticket Office in the Student Union for $40.  410-704-2244.
  • Game Day Purchase: There will be a parking attendant in each lot collect $5 per car for every game.

Department Guests

Individuals visiting campus as the guest of a department may be eligible to obtain a coupon code for complimentary parking paid for by the department.  Guests should contact the faculty/staff member arranging their visit to determine if the department will pay their parking fee. 

Events

Major Campus Events Affecting Parking

The university hosts various major events that may affect parking on campus. During these events, parking may not be available in particular areas or may be subject to special restrictions and/or fees.

Planning for Event Parking

Departments and event coordinators must contact parking services to schedule parking arrangements for all events that require 10 or more parking spaces, no matter whether there is an associated parking fee or the event is being held during non-peak hours, including weekends.  An event parking request form must be completed and submitted to parking services prior to scheduling an event date or location. At its discretion parking services will determine if parking will be available for the event.  If it is, parking services will determine the lot location and notify the department.
